Shoecarnival is a company that sells shoes for women, men and kids online. It has partnered
with several shoe brands from all across the globe to make sure that the customers get their
desired shoes. The following are the primary functions that are performed by the company:
Selling of various shoe types and products for women, men and kids.
Collaborating with shoe brands to include their catalogue on the site.
Selling of accessories, such as, backpacks, duffle bags, handbags etc.
There are various shoe brands that are already associated with the company like Adidas,
Puma, Vans, Clarks, and Converse etc. It is required to collaborate with more brands to offer
wider range of shoes to the customers. Also, the expansion of the customer base is intended
by the company. The solution proposed for the same is the integration of social media

Business Model of Shoecarnival
There are two business models that have been proposed for Shoecarnival. The first model is
the Business to Consumer (B2C) model which will include the strategies and business
decisions that will be taken to expand the customer base. The primary decision in this area
will be the enhanced use and promotion of the company on the social media platforms and
development of a mobile application for the company (Martinez-Lopez, 2010). The second
model will be Business to Business (B2B) model which would include the strategies and
business decisions that will be taken for collaboration with the shoe brands and sellers in the
market (Pandya and Dholakia, 2005).

Privacy, Security and Legal Issues
Legal Issues
There are various legal policies and regulations that shall be adhered to in case of the mobile
application for Shoecarnival. The electronic payments that are made with the application
shall be secure and there must be e-payments code followed in all of such transactions.
Foreign exchange systems and government agencies must also be collaborated with the
application. There are several malicious codes that may attack the payment information and
transactions. These payment transactions shall be secured by making use of Safepay or other
anti-malware tools (Uop. 2006).
Intellectual property laws and regulations shall also be followed in the application.
Privacy and Security Issues
The use of mobile application in Shoecarnival may bring in many different mobile security
risks and attacks. These risks may be in the form of information security or network security
risks and threats. These may have an adverse impact on the privacy, confidentiality and
security of the customer data and product details stored in the application.
The impact of such attacks can be low to extremely significant in nature. For instance, in case
of the breaching of financial information of a customer, there may be legal impacts and
obligations on Shoecarnival (Onebusiness, 2013).
The different forms of attacks may include malware attacks and risks, network eavesdropping
attacks, man in the middle attacks, SQL injection attacks, information breaches, information
losses and leakage along with many more.
Information availability may also be impacted by the execution of the attacks such as denial
of service and distributed denial of service attacks. There are also other forms of flooding
attacks that may take place.
Many different security controls shall be implemented to make sure that the privacy and
security risks associated with the mobile application do not take place. These controls shall
include a combination of logical controls along with enhancement of administrative policies.

These technical controls shall include the use and implementation of anti-malware and anti-
denial tools along with network scanners and intrusion detection systems. There shall also be
enhanced monitoring and review practices that must be carried out.
Other Risks
E-commerce and mobile commerce are not the new trends in the market. There are already a
number of business units that have their presence on the online platforms including mobile
mediums. Due to this reason, there may be market risks associated with the solution that has
been proposed for Shoecarnival.
It will be required to develop the strategies and include the features in the mobile application
that are not being offered with any of the competitors. These may include promotional offers,
discounts and deals.
There will also be numerous changes that may come up with the business operations and their
mode of execution. The members of staff may take a little while to easily adapt with the
changes. This may have an adverse impact on the productivity and efficiency levels.
An initial round of training will be required to be provided to the employees and the end-
users along with the inclusion of system documentation. In case of absence of these system
documents or the training sessions, there may be technical and operational errors executed by
the users. Some of these errors may lead to impacts that may not be allowed to be rolled back.
